Background and Objective: Prostate cancer is among the five common cancers in males. It is second cancer in terms of the age-standardized rate (ASR) (ASR=16.6) in Iran. The rs2735839 G/A, an intergenic polymorphism is located on chromosome 19q13.33 at 600 base pairs of the KLK3 gene untranslatable region. Background: Klebsiella pneumoniae is one of the most important causes of nosocomial infections, especially wound infection after surgery. One of the mechanisms of antibiotic resistance in K. pneumoniae strains, especially ciprofloxacin, is the presence of efflux pump. The objective of this study was to search for single nucleotide polymorphism (SNP)-type polymorphisms in the dopamine D1 receptor in West Azerbaijani native chicken and look for their association with egg production and body weight traits of chickens by polymerase chain reaction-single strand conformation polymorphism (PCR-SSCP). Diabetes Mellitus (DM) is a metabolic disease that developed due to the pancreas does not sufficient produce insulin or body cannot effectively use it produces. Genetic factors have an essential role in development of Type 2 (DMT2), which impaired production by pancreatic β cells, resistance, and action.
